Beate Clausdatter Bille was a Danish noblewoman, a member of the royal court, Chief Lady-in-Waiting to Queen Sophie from 1584 to 1592, the wife of statesman Otte Brahe, and a feudal fiefholder in her own right following the death of her husband.
Career
Beate Bille was the mother of astronomer Tycho Brahe. Her husband held substantial fiefdoms. After his death in 1571, Beate Bille kept the fiefdom of Froste in Scania and Vissenbjerg Birk at Fyn until 1575, and Rødinge fief in Scania until 1592.

Born at Skarhult into the powerful and ancient noble Bille family, at 18 years old she married Otte Brahe of Knudstrup, a member of the equally powerful noble Brahe family.
